Understanding Backlinks: What They Are & Why They Matter
Backlinks, also known as incoming links , are fundamentally links from another site to your site . Think of them as endorsements for your online information. Platforms like Google like web indexes use backlinks as a crucial factor to assess the relevance and quality of a digital asset. The more the amount of high-quality backlinks you earn, the improved your page’s ranking in search results is likely to be, which can generate more organic traffic to your site .

Toxic Backlinks: How to Identify & Disavow Them
Harmful backlinks can seriously impact your website's position in the SERP results, essentially diminishing all your hard work . Recognizing these undesirable links is crucial for maintaining a good backlink presence. Here's a quick guide to spotting them and taking action them. First, employ backlink audit tools like Moz to assess your backlink portfolio. Look for links from suspicious websites – those with poor content, off-topic themes, or a questionable reputation . Pay attention unsolicited link placements, such as numerous link building or links from websites that seem artificial.
Examine anchor text - keyword-stuffed anchor text can flag a possible issue.
Analyze domain rating - Links from domains with very low authority are usually unhelpful .
Monitor referral traffic – unexplained traffic from a specific site can be a warning sign .
If you've located toxic backlinks, don't try to manually remove them yourself; instead, submit Google's disavow function. Note that disavowing backlinks is a powerful action , so proceed with diligence.

Contributed Blogging for Link Building : A Step-by-Step Approach
Securing high-quality backlinks is essential for boosting your website's visibility and position in search engines . Guest blogging is a proven method to achieve this, but it requires a thoughtful approach. First, identify relevant websites in your niche that feature guest posts. Then, submit compelling topic ideas that fit with their community. Write outstanding posts full with insightful information. Ultimately, incorporate a relevant link back to your company's site within the author section or, where permitted, throughout the body of your post . Remember to follow the publication's instructions carefully for best results.
